Who’s involved
The [Harvard Biorobotics Lab](/companies/harvard-biorobotics) (formally the Harvard Microrobotics Lab) develops insect-scale flying robots including the [RoboBee](/models/robobee) — a microrobot capable of flight, diving, and perching. Led by Professor Robert Wood, the lab pioneers soft robotics, microfabrication, and bio-inspired microrobots.
World leader in accelerated computing and AI (NASDAQ: NVDA). In physical AI, NVIDIA develops the Isaac robotics platform: the GR00T open foundation model, Jetson edge compute (AGX Thor), Isaac Lab and Isaac Sim simulation environments, and Omniverse. NVIDIA positions itself as the platform layer for the humanoid industry. Developer of [GR00T N1](/brains/gr00t-n1), the first open humanoid foundation model.
